What are the responsibilities and job description for the Learning and Development Manager position at Truebeck Construction?
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
PROGRAM MANAGEMENT
• Collaborate with department managers and leadership team to align learning goals with corporate strategy
• Identify current and forecast future training needs
• Oversee design and creation of training solutions utilizing a wide variety of training methods
• Create and implement marketing strategy to promote Truebeck’s learning culture
• Recommend and manage training materials, equipment, and facilities, ensuring they align with budgetary guidelines
• Remain current on developments in training and instructional methodologies. Attend periodic seminars, forums and meetings to ensure currency of programs
• Collaborate across the organization to identify and/or develop training for operations and non-operations job families
• Create in-house content and partner with third party providers to provide coaching, classroom training, and e-learning, etc.
• Schedule monthly in person training topics for operations team
• Create and manage a comprehensive training plans
• Monitor and evaluate training program’s effectiveness
• Maintain metrics and records of training activities, participation progress, program effectiveness and calendars through detailed reporting methods
• Conduct pre and post event evaluations and report on outcomes and potential actions to stakeholders
• Use learning metrics and analytics to measure the impact of training programs
• Any other task or duty as assigned or required
INSTRUCTIONAL DESIGN
• Utilize adult learning principles to create an active learning experience; eliminate common learning barriers and ensure strong learning objectives
• Ensure a variety of delivery methods to ensure active learning to improve learning and retention.
• Understand the importance of measuring training and use common models (ADDIE, Kirkpatrick Four Levels, Phillips ROI, NPS Scores, etc.), manage data collection, analyze data, and apply learning analytics to ensure effective training outcomes and modify as needed
• Create a consistent process, each containing deliverable milestones with the purpose of moving, challenging the design for appropriateness, and building the final deliverable
• In collaboration with the HRIS Administrator, plans and implements ongoing LMS improvements to support the administration of the training program and Truebeck’s culture of learning
